Answer:

The volume of cylinder and the volume of a cone, have equal volume measurements. So, the answer is C).

Explanation:

Cylinder:

-Use the formula for the volume of a cylinder. Use both the radius and height for the formula in order to solve and get the volume:


V = \pi r^2 h


V = \pi 2^2 6

-Solve:


V = \pi 2^2 6


V = \pi * 2^2 * 6


V = \pi * 4 * 6


V = \pi * 24


V = 24\pi \approx 75.39

--------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

Cone:

-Use the formula for the volume of a cone and the radius and height for the formula and solve the formula to get the volume:


V = (1)/(3) \pi r^2h


V = (1)/(3) \pi 3^28

-Solve:


V = (1)/(3) \pi 3^28


V = (1)/(3) * \pi * 3^2 * 8


V = (1)/(3) * \pi * 9 * 8


V = (1)/(3) * \pi * 72


V = (1)/(3) \pi * 72


V = 24\pi \approx 75.39

-So, according to the volume of a cylinder and the volume of a cone, They both have the same volume.

Cylinder:
75.39
ft^3

Cone:
75.39
ft^3
